Mysticks1 Posted February 11, 2014 #4 Share Posted February 11, 2014 There are no noise reports on Cruisedeckplans about that cabin. On the Dream there are some noise reports for those under the aft pool deck. They reported noise approx. 10 at night as they stacked the chairs and cleaned and then again around 6:00 AM when they put them back out. I would suggest bringing ear plugs with you just in case. smc0320 Posted February 12, 2014 #6 Share Posted February 12, 2014 We had same cabin on Legend & Miracle before the aft deck had the "serenity" furniture. We never had issues with noise from above. Deck chairs are put out in the am when we were at breakfast or having breakfast on that gorgeous wrap balcony. In the evenings, deck chairs were put away while we were getting ready for dinner or were at dinner. At those times, you coincide here some noise, but not at all like on the newer ships with that awful decking they have. During the day, when we napped, we didn't hear much if anything either. 8th deck us the best! Just one flight up to pool of food! You will not regret the aft wrap vista suites!
